| 0:00.0 | Bring in show music, please. |
| 0:03.0 | Hi, I'm CNBC producer Katie Kramer. |
| 0:07.0 | Today, on Swak Pod, President Donald Trump, a wide-ranging interview. |
| 0:12.0 | Firing the Labor Department's data commissioner after a disappointing jobs number. |
| 0:17.0 | When they say that nobody was involved, that it wasn't political, give me a break. |
| 0:23.9 | How he's remaking the American economy with tariffs. |
| 0:27.9 | On pharmaceuticals, we'll be putting an initially small tariff on pharmaceuticals. |
| 0:33.6 | But in one year, one and a half years maximum, it's going to go to 150 percent and then it's going to go to 250 percent. |
| 0:42.5 | The drawn-out public feud with the Federal Reserve Chair, Jay Powell. |
| 0:47.3 | Who would you replace him with? |
| 0:48.8 | I know you watch a show occasionally and we had an extended interview with one of the prospective replacements, |
| 0:55.7 | Kevin Warsh. Were you watching that day or? |
| 0:58.0 | I was. He's very good. He's very good. Sometimes they're all very good until you put them |
| 1:03.4 | in there and then they don't do so good. |
| 1:05.4 | And eyeing a replacement, even from his own team like National Economic Council Director |
| 1:10.8 | Kevin Hassett. |
| 1:11.6 | I say Kevin and Kevin. Both Kevins are very good. |
| 1:14.6 | You'll hear the full interview from the policy to the politics only right here. |
| 1:20.6 | I got the highest vote in the history of Texas, a record that they say won't be beaten unless I run again. |
| 1:26.6 | Are you going to run again? |
| 1:28.1 | The Constitution. |
| 1:29.1 | No, probably not. |
